Allen Henry Geffe better known as Popper, went home to his Heavenly family on September 30, 2025. 

The first-born son of Henry and Alice (nee Gruebnau) Geffe. Allen loved learning and was always up for a new adventure. Upon graduating from Palatine High in 1958 he and a buddy set off on Route 66 to go to college in CA. Realizing he wasn’t ready to settle down for school, Allen joined the Navy and sailed the seven seas. He talked fondly of his time in the Navy and loved all the travel. After the Navy he returned to work in Illinois where he met his lifelong love Judy (nee Fender) they married on Sept. 26, 1964.

 Their daughter Colleen was born in 1965, it was during this time that Allen discovered he had the eye disease Retina Pigmentosa. Never one to let anything stop him, he and Judy bought a resort in Henning, MN. Many happy memories were created at Middle Leaf Resort. Often customers would find Allen in the store ready with a joke or listening to books on tape. He also became a founding member of the Henning Lions Club. 

In 1977, the family headed off to a new experience, Fergus Falls community college where he was just going to take a few business classes. This led to a degree from the University Minnesota Morris, graduating Magna Cum Laude and being the first in the Geffe family to earn a BA. Upon graduating, Allen and Judy decided again to become business owners running the Ottertail laundromat and car wash. Day or night the customers there could find Allen holding a 3lb. coffee can full of quarters, practicing his Spanish and ready with a funny story to share. As an active member of the Ottertail community, he served on the Business Association and City Council. Allen never let his blindness stop him. 

Shortly before retiring, Allen convinced his daughter and son in law, Thor Dahle, to take scuba lesson with him, reigniting a passion from his high school days. From Lake Superior to the Caribbean, Allen and Thor made over 100 dives. The freedom of scuba diving brought him great joy and countless stories. His most important joy was watching his family grow, from his daughter Colleen and son-in-law Thor. He was very proud of his grandsons and their families - Noah (Emily) and great grandchildren Calvin & Zoe - Seth (Bridgett) and great grandsons Oliver & Nyle. Allen is preceded in death by his brother, Gordon and parents, Alice and Henry.
